West Ham United midfielder Jack Wilshere underwent ankle surgery this week after reportedly feeling discomfort last week in training, and a spell on the sidelines could highlight a huge blunder in the transfer window.

West Ham confirmed on their official website that the 26-year-old underwent surgery in London on Monday morning and is now expected to be on the sidelines for quite some time.

He is expected to be given time to rest and recover before undergoing a rehabilitation process. It is unclear when exactly he will return to action for the club he signed for this summer.

England international Wilshere is renowned for his injury problems and although it seems as if the worst of it is behind him, this setback will do the former Arsenal star no favours in looking to shake off his injury-prone reputation.

The Hammers and Manuel Pellegrini now have just Pedro Obiang, Mark Noble, Declan Rice and Carlos Sanchez to choose from in central midfield, but all four are renowned for their defensive work rather than getting forward.

With Manuel Lanzini sidelined for the majority of the 2018-19 season, West Ham lack the kind of player to connect the midfield and attack following Wilshere’s injury.

Indeed, Pellegrini will surely be ruing his decision to allow Edimilson Fernandes to join Fiorentina on a season-long loan, as well as agreeing to let Josh Cullen move to Charlton Athletic.

Both loan stars are more than capable of getting forward to join the attack, much like Wilshere does. But without all three, West Ham are without the attacking connection from deep.

Wilshere’s injury, then, highlights a hole in the middle of the park that Pellegrini really should have planned for – given Wilshere’s track record when it comes to inury.
